What is Acute Myeloid Leukemia?

Acute myeloid leukemia is a type of cancer that affects the myeloid cells in the bone marrow. for beginners are accountable for producing red cell, leukocyte, and platelets. In AML, the myeloid cells become unusual and begin to grow and increase frantically, leading to an accumulation of malignant cells in the bone marrow and blood.

How to File a Railroad Settlement Claim

If you or a loved one is a railroad employee who has actually established AML, you may be qualified to sue for payment. Here are the actions to follow:

  1. Consult with an attorney: It is important to speak with a lawyer who has experience handling railroad settlement claims. They can assist you understand your rights and options.
  2. Gather medical records: You will need to gather medical records that record your AML diagnosis and treatment.
  3. Collect work records: You will need to gather work records that record your work history and direct exposure to harmful chemicals.
  4. File a claim: Your legal representative can assist you submit a claim with the railroad company or other responsible parties.

Regularly Asked Questions

Q: What is the statute of constraints for filing a railroad settlement claim?

A: The statute of constraints for submitting a railroad settlement claim varies by state and can vary from 2 to 5 years.

Q: Can I file a claim if I am still working for the railroad company?

A: Yes, you can sue if you are still working for the railroad company. However, it is necessary to consult with an attorney to make sure that you are secured from retaliation.

Q: How long does it require to solve a railroad settlement claim?

A: The length of time it requires to fix a railroad settlement claim can vary depending upon the intricacy of the case and the willingness of the celebrations to settle. It can take several months to several years to fix a claim.

Q: Can I submit a claim on behalf of a liked one who has died?

A: Yes, you can sue on behalf of a loved one who has died. This kind of claim is called a wrongful death claim.
